Team Asobi has recently released five new challenge levels for Astro Bot. These new Vicious Void Galaxy levels are the latest free DLC provided by the Astro Bot developers, and they’re intended to test the skills of veteran players due to their difficult challenges.

Released in September 2024, Astro Bot was a huge hit. Astro Bot won Game of the Year at The Game Awards 2024, as well as Best Game Direction, Best Family Game, and Best Action/Adventure.

Now, Team Asobi has released five new challenge levels in the Vicious Void Galaxy, which are free to all players. The levels include Twin-Frog Trouble, Suck It Up, Handhold Havoc, High Inflation, and a secret fifth one called Megamix Mastery. While the first four levels focus on individual abilities that should be used to complete them, Megamix Mastery requires multiple skills to be employed, and has already been well-received by the community on social media.

According to the developers, these new levels also come with their own Special Bots. Last month, it was revealed that Ghost of Yotei’s main character Atsu would appear in Astro Bot, being voiced by Erika Ishii. After unveiling the five new levels, Sony also revealed an updated version of the Astro Bot Limited Edition DualSense wireless controller, which is set to be released “later this year.”

These five levels are just the latest round of free DLC for Astro Bot. Last year, Team Asobi released six new levels for Astro Bot, with five speedrun levels being added to the Stellar Speedway Galaxy between October and November, and one additional Christmas-themed level at the year’s end. Earlier this year, the devs also added five challenge levels to the Vicious Void Galaxy, bringing more VIP bots to the game, such as Heihachi Mishima from the Tekken series, and Jade from Beyond Good and Evil.
